Media Professionals vs Rail and rolling stock builders and repairers Salary (2025)
How do Media Professionals and Rail and rolling stock builders and repairers sal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Rail and rolling stock builders and repairers earns £19,171 more per year (46% higher)
vs
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Media Professionals | Rail and rolling stock builders and repairers |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£41,593 | £60,764 | -£19,171 |
| Mean Annual | £45,271 | £62,454 | -£17,183 |
| Monthly | £3,466 | £5,064 | -£1,598 |
| Weekly | £800 | £1,169 | -£369 |
| Hourly | £20.00 | £29.21 | -£9.21 |
